Title: A Measurement of the Weak Charge of the Proton through Parity Violating Electron Scattering using the Q{sub weak} Apparatus

Conference · · Nucl.Phys.Proc.Suppl.

After a decade of preparations, the Q{sub weak} experiment at Jefferson Lab is making the first direct measurement of the weak charge of the proton, Q{sub weak}. Because this quantity is suppressed in the Standard Model, a 4% result will significantly constrain new physics at the TeV scale while providing the most precise measurement of sin{sup 2}{theta}{sub W} at low energies. Operationally, we measure the small (about -0.220 ppm) parity violating asymmetry in electron-proton scattering in integrating mode while flipping the longitudinal polarization of the electrons up to 1000 times per second. Potential sources of new, parity violating interactions between electrons and light quarks include a Z', lepto-quarks, and parity violating SUSY interactions. The result presented here is based on the data taken during an initial two weeks period which included a 16.7% measurement of the parity violating electron-proton ({vec e}p) scattering asymmetry, A=-0.279{+-}0.035(stat.){+-}0.031(syst.) ppm at Q{sup 2}=0.0250{+-}0.0006(GeV){sup 2}. The weak charge of the proton is extracted by performing a global analysis on parity violating electron scattering (PVES) asymmetries on nuclear targets and it is Q{sub W}{sup p}=0.064{+-}0.012. Then effective vector couplings of the up/down quarks (C{sub 1u}/C{sub 1d}) and weak charge of the neutron are extracted by combining precise {sup 133}Cs atomic parity violating (APV) measurement and PVES measurements. The result is a proof of principle for the analysis of the full Q{sub weak} data to be completed in the near future.
